- মাইক্রোসফট ঘোষণা করেছে যে উইন্ডোজ সাবসিস্টেম ফর লিনাক্স (WSL) ওপেন সোর্স হয়ে উঠছে, যা ডেভেলপমেন্ট ইকোসিস্টেমের মধ্যে আরও স্বচ্ছতা এবং সহযোগিতা সক্ষম করবে।
- WSL কোডটি এখন GitHub-এ উপলব্ধ, কারিগরি কারণে ছোট, বিচ্ছিন্ন উপাদানগুলি বাদ দিয়ে যা মূল কার্যকারিতাকে প্রভাবিত করে না।
- এই পদক্ষেপটি দীর্ঘদিনের সম্প্রদায়ের দাবির প্রতি সাড়া দেয় এবং কাঁটাচামচ এবং বহিরাগত অবদানের দরজা খুলে দেয়, মাইক্রোসফ্টের সিদ্ধান্ত নির্বিশেষে এর পরিচালনা এবং ভবিষ্যতের রক্ষণাবেক্ষণের অধ্যয়নকে সহজতর করে।
- উইন্ডোজের সাথে লিনাক্স অ্যাপ্লিকেশন এবং পরিবেশকে একীভূত করার জন্য WSL একটি গুরুত্বপূর্ণ হাতিয়ার হয়ে উঠেছে, যা আন্তঃকার্যক্ষমতা এবং ওপেন সোর্স সফ্টওয়্যারের দিকে মাইক্রোসফটের কৌশলগত পরিবর্তনের প্রমাণ দেয়।

উইন্ডোজ সফটওয়্যার ডেভেলপমেন্টের ল্যান্ডস্কেপ একটি অভিজ্ঞতা অর্জন করছে লিনাক্সের জন্য উইন্ডোজ সাবসিস্টেম (WSL) খোলার ঘোষণার পর মাইক্রোসফটের উল্লেখযোগ্য পরিবর্তন একটি ওপেন সোর্স প্রকল্প হিসেবে। এই সিদ্ধান্তটি ডেভেলপার সম্প্রদায়ের বছরের পর বছর ধরে চলমান একটি অনুরোধের প্রেক্ষিতে নেওয়া হয়েছে, যারা চেয়েছিল নিরীক্ষণ, কাস্টমাইজেশন এবং বিবর্তনের বৃহত্তর সহজতা মাইক্রোসফট অপারেটিং সিস্টেমের মধ্যে এই মৌলিক হাতিয়ারটির।
মুক্তির তারিখ WSL সোর্স কোড (WSL ওপেন সোর্স), এখন অ্যাক্সেসযোগ্য GitHub প্ল্যাটফর্মের মাধ্যমে, এর অর্থ হল এর কার্যত সমস্ত উপাদানই যেকোনো বহিরাগত ব্যবহারকারী বা বিকাশকারী দ্বারা বিশ্লেষণ, অভিযোজিত বা পুনঃব্যবহার করা যেতে পারে। শুধুমাত্র যারা বাদ পড়েছে সেকেন্ডারি কম্পোনেন্ট, যেমন LXcore.sys ড্রাইভার এবং ফাইল রিডাইরেকশনের সাথে যুক্ত কিছু রিসোর্স, যার অনুপস্থিতি সাবসিস্টেমের স্বাভাবিক ক্রিয়াকলাপকে প্রভাবিত করে না।
সহযোগিতা এবং বিনামূল্যের সফটওয়্যারের দিকে একটি কৌশলগত অগ্রগতি
মাইক্রোসফট অনেক আগেই দেখিয়ে আসছে বিনামূল্যের সফটওয়্যারের প্রতি তার দৃষ্টিভঙ্গিতে গুরুত্বপূর্ণ পরিবর্তন. WSL-এর প্রাথমিক ইন্টিগ্রেশনের ফলে উইন্ডোজ ব্যবহারকারীরা স্থানীয়ভাবে লিনাক্স অ্যাপ্লিকেশন বা ডিস্ট্রিবিউশন চালানোর সুযোগ পেয়েছিলেন, যা মাত্র এক দশক আগেও কল্পনাতীত ছিল। তারপর থেকে, কোম্পানিটি এই প্ল্যাটফর্মের প্রতি তার প্রতিশ্রুতি জোরদার করে চলেছে।
ওপেন সোর্সে WSL-এর পদক্ষেপ কেবল স্বচ্ছতা প্রচার করে না, কিন্তু তৃতীয় পক্ষের জন্য এর রক্ষণাবেক্ষণের দায়িত্ব নেওয়ার সম্ভাবনা উন্মুক্ত করে যদি মাইক্রোসফট প্রকল্পটি পরিত্যাগ করার সিদ্ধান্ত নেয়, যেমনটি তার সময়ে অ্যান্ড্রয়েডের জন্য উইন্ডোজ সাবসিস্টেমের সাথে হয়েছিল।
এই পরিবর্তন বিশেষজ্ঞ এবং ব্যবসা উভয়কেই তাদের নিজস্ব চাহিদা অনুসারে WSL-কে খাপ খাইয়ে নিতে, নতুন বৈশিষ্ট্যগুলির সুবিধা নিতে, অথবা ফর্কের মাধ্যমে বিকল্প পথ অন্বেষণ করতে সাহায্য করে। সম্প্রদায়ের জন্য, এটি প্রমাণ যে মাইক্রোসফট অন্যান্য অপারেটিং সিস্টেমের সাথে আন্তঃকার্যক্ষমতা এবং সংলাপের জন্য প্রতিশ্রুতিবদ্ধ।, বিশেষ করে Azure পাবলিক ক্লাউডের মতো প্রেক্ষাপটে, যেখানে Linux ইতিমধ্যেই কাজের চাপের একটি উল্লেখযোগ্য অংশ প্রতিনিধিত্ব করে।
ডেভেলপার এবং উন্নত ব্যবহারকারীদের জন্য একটি হাতিয়ার হিসেবে WSL
নয় বছর আগে বিল্ডে আত্মপ্রকাশের পর থেকে লিনাক্সের জন্য উইন্ডোজ সাবসিস্টেম জনপ্রিয়তা অর্জন করছে। প্রথম সংস্করণে শুধুমাত্র ব্যাশ ইন্টারপ্রেটারে সীমিত অ্যাক্সেস দেওয়া হয়েছিল, কিন্তু ক্রমাগত আপডেটগুলি এর নাগাল প্রসারিত করেছে উইন্ডোজের মধ্যে বিভিন্ন ধরণের লিনাক্স অ্যাপ্লিকেশন চালানোর অনুমতি দেওয়ার জন্য।
কার্যকরী দৃষ্টিকোণ থেকে, WSL ডেভেলপার এবং পেশাদারদের জীবনকে সহজ করে তোলে যার জন্য মিশ্র পরিবেশের প্রয়োজন হয়, ভার্চুয়াল মেশিন বা জটিল দ্বৈত ইনস্টলেশনের প্রয়োজন ছাড়াই উইন্ডোজ ডেস্কটপে লিনাক্স ইউটিলিটি, কনসোল এবং সরঞ্জামগুলিকে একীভূত করা হয়।
অনেক ব্যবহারকারী এই নমনীয়তাকে মূল্য দেন, যদিও অভিজ্ঞতাটি এখনও একটি নেটিভ লিনাক্স ইনস্টলেশনের সাথে মেলে না।. তবে, দুটি মহান বাস্তুতন্ত্রের মধ্যে একটি সেতু হিসেবে, WSL নিজেকে একটি অত্যন্ত কার্যকর সম্পদ হিসেবে প্রতিষ্ঠিত করেছে, পরিচিত উইন্ডোজ পরিবেশ ত্যাগ না করেই বিনামূল্যের সফটওয়্যারের অনেক সুবিধা অ্যাক্সেস করার অনুমতি দেয়।
ওপেন সোর্স হিসেবে WSL-এর প্রভাব এবং ভবিষ্যৎ
মাইক্রোসফটকে এই পদক্ষেপ নিতে প্ররোচিত করার কারণগুলির মধ্যে রয়েছে উভয়ই প্রযুক্তিগত এবং কৌশলগত কারণগুলি. কোড প্রকাশের ফলে নিরীক্ষাযোগ্যতার সম্ভাবনা বহুগুণ বৃদ্ধি পায়, উদ্ভাবনকে উৎসাহিত করে এবং সম্প্রদায়কে সম্ভাব্য সমস্যা সমাধানে সাহায্য করতে বা পণ্যটিকে নতুন দিকে বিকশিত করতে সাহায্য করার সুযোগ দেয়.
ডেভেলপারদের জন্য, একটি খোলা WSL থাকার অর্থ হল টুলের আচরণের উপর অধিকতর নিয়ন্ত্রণ, আরও কাস্টমাইজেশন বিকল্প এবং সহযোগিতামূলক কাজ এবং কোড স্বচ্ছতার জন্য সম্ভাব্য সমস্যার আরও দ্রুত সমাধান খুঁজে বের করার সুযোগ।
এই পরিমাপটিকে এভাবেও ব্যাখ্যা করা যেতে পারে ওপেন সোর্স ইকোসিস্টেমের মধ্যে মাইক্রোসফটের ভাবমূর্তি আরও শক্তিশালী করার একটি প্রচেষ্টা, এবং ঐতিহ্যগতভাবে বিশুদ্ধ লিনাক্স পরিবেশে কাজ করে এমন প্রোফাইলগুলিকে তার প্ল্যাটফর্মে আকৃষ্ট করতে, বিশেষ করে কৃত্রিম বুদ্ধিমত্তা, ক্লাউড এবং অটোমেশনের সাথে যুক্ত উন্নয়নগুলিতে।
মধ্যমেয়াদে, আশা করা যায় যে প্রকল্পের ডেরিভেটিভস প্রদর্শিত হয় অথবা সম্প্রদায়ের সরাসরি অবদানের উন্নতি, যা উভয় সিস্টেমের সাথে সহাবস্থানের প্রয়োজন এমন ব্যক্তিদের জন্য একটি পরিবেশ হিসেবে উইন্ডোজের আকর্ষণকে আরও বাড়িয়ে তোলে।
WSL-এর ওপেন সোর্সে রূপান্তর একটি উইন্ডোজ এবং লিনাক্সের মধ্যে সম্পর্কের নতুন স্তর, এবং এমন একটি দৃশ্যপট উপস্থাপন করে যেখানে সফটওয়্যার জগতে সহযোগিতা এবং স্বচ্ছতা গুরুত্ব পায়, যা ডেভেলপার, কোম্পানি এবং ব্যক্তিগত ব্যবহারকারীদের উপকার করে।
আমি একজন প্রযুক্তি উত্সাহী যিনি তার "গীক" আগ্রহকে একটি পেশায় পরিণত করেছেন। আমি আমার জীবনের 10 বছরেরও বেশি সময় অতিবাহিত করেছি অত্যাধুনিক প্রযুক্তি ব্যবহার করে এবং বিশুদ্ধ কৌতূহল থেকে সমস্ত ধরণের প্রোগ্রামের সাথে টিঙ্কারিং করে। এখন আমি কম্পিউটার প্রযুক্তি এবং ভিডিও গেমে বিশেষায়িত হয়েছি। এর কারণ হল 5 বছরেরও বেশি সময় ধরে আমি প্রযুক্তি এবং ভিডিও গেমগুলির উপর বিভিন্ন ওয়েবসাইটের জন্য লিখছি, এমন নিবন্ধ তৈরি করছি যা আপনাকে এমন একটি ভাষায় আপনার প্রয়োজনীয় তথ্য দিতে চায় যা প্রত্যেকের বোধগম্য।
যদি আপনার কোন প্রশ্ন থাকে, আমার জ্ঞান উইন্ডোজ অপারেটিং সিস্টেমের সাথে সাথে মোবাইল ফোনের জন্য অ্যান্ড্রয়েড সম্পর্কিত সবকিছু থেকে শুরু করে। এবং আমার প্রতিশ্রুতি আপনার প্রতি, আমি সর্বদা কয়েক মিনিট সময় ব্যয় করতে এবং এই ইন্টারনেট জগতে আপনার যে কোনও প্রশ্নের সমাধান করতে সাহায্য করতে ইচ্ছুক।


